よく混同される語
연속적이다 emphasizes things happening 'in a row' (sequence), while 지속적이다 emphasizes 'maintaining a state' over time.
使い方のコツ
Often used with numbers (e.g., 5회 연속) to mean 'in a row'.
よくある間違い
Learners sometimes use '연속' when they mean '반복' (repetition).

語源
From Sino-Korean 連 (connect) + 續 (continue) + 的 (suffix).
